Unconditional Love



God’s love for us is unconditional and unchanging.




“Then the world will know that you [God the Father] sent me [Jesus Christ] and will understand that you love them as much as you love me” (John 17:23, NLT).



Did you catch that? God loves you as much as He loves Jesus! That’s almost too much to comprehend!



Scripture records that God’s love “never fails [never fades out or becomes obsolete or comes to an end]” (1 Corinthians 13:8, AMP). His love for you can never weaken. It's impossible. His love for you isn’t based on your behavior but on His faithfulness.



God’s love for us is so all-encompassing that we simply cannot comprehend its scope.



“For God so loved the world [you and me] that He gave His only begotten Son, that whoever believes in Him should not perish but have everlasting life” (John 3:16).



Why did God give Jesus? The answer is simple: to purchase us back. Our forefather Adam gave himself, and consequently all his offspring (including you and me), to a new lord when he heeded Satan. Adam disobeyed God and separated himself and his descendants from Him. But since God loved each of us so much, He wasn’t willing to assign us the same fate as Satan and his angels.



God purchased our relationship back with Him by giving Jesus in our place. Jesus paid the complete price for mankind's disobedience to God. He took our judgment.



The price of our soul is so expensive that nothing else could have bought us back besides Jesus Himself. “God bought you with a high price” (1 Corinthians 6:20, NLT). “He purchased our freedom through the blood of his Son” (Ephesians 1:7, NLT).



No person or thing is more valuable to God than Jesus. Yet, God saw our value equal to that of what He prized most.



Now here is the amazing fact: If you and I had been worth one cent less to God than the value of His Son, He wouldn't have purchased us because God would never make an unprofitable deal. (Recall the above scripture, “God bought you with a high price.”) A bad purchase is when you give something of more value for something of less value.



In God’s eyes, Jesus’ value is the same as yours! Do you see how important you are to God? This is why Jesus prays, “You love them as much as you love me” (John 17:23, NLT).

Sunday, September 13, 2009

Let GOD.....

Your destiny is not fixed.

Do you sometimes feel that through poor choices you have squandered your opportunities to live the life you once dreamed of? Is your life full of guilt and regret? Do you sometimes wish you could turn the clock back and start over?

Unfortunately, you can't relive your past. But your past does not have to determine your future . Turn your future over to God and He can turn it around. He can alter your destiny and change your reputation. Just consider Jacob, the “deceiver,” who cheated his brother Esau out of his birthright. Later, however, he wrestled with God, who changed his name to Israel , “prince of God,” and who made him the father of the nation that bore his name.

Then there's Moses, a murderer and fugitive in the desert whose destiny was altered at a burning bush. His encounter with God changed him into a deliverer who freed a nation from slavery.

God is in the destiny-altering and reputation-changing business. Just look at Saul. On his way to Damascus to arrest followers of Christ, he met the Lord on the road. Blinded temporarily by the encounter, Saul rested at the home of a man named Judas. In the meantime, God instructed Ananias to go to Saul and restore his sight, saying, “Go, for he is a chosen vessel of Mine to bear My name before Gentiles, kings, and the children of Israel .”

Saul thought his destiny was to rid the land of the Jesus-followers. God altered his destiny and his reputation. As Paul, he became one of the most potent forces in spreading the gospel of Christ throughout the Roman Empire in the first century. When they saw how he was boldly preaching the faith he once tried to destroy, they glorified God because of him.

What God did for Paul and all these others He can do for you. Do you feel like you have messed up your life? God can straighten things out and set you on the right road. There is no sin so great that God's grace is not greater still. No hole so deep that God's love cannot reach you and pull you out. Remember that one day of favor can be worth more than a lifetime of labor. At the same time, one day of favor can change a lifetime of mistakes, bad choices and missed opportunities .

Don't let the shame or discouragement of your past rob you of your future. Turn to the One who can alter your destiny and change your reputation. Let God turn you around!

Forgivness?


So often, people hold on to bitterness or resentment, thinking that they are stockpiling ammunition against the person who hurt or offended them as if one day, they'll have the chance to get even. However, the truth is, if you don't choose to forgive, the only person being punished is you.

Unforgiveness is like a barrier that actually blocks the door to your heart. In order to move forward, you must remove the barrier, open the door of your heart, and extend forgiveness to others. When the door of your heart is open, you can then release all the hurt and pain and make room for God's healing.

I heard a story about a woman in her mid–thirties who had been mistreated, abused, abandoned, and neglected throughout her life. She was a believer, yet she was still consumed with feelings of betrayal, anger, and hurt. At times, she sat up nights imagining confrontations with the people who had hurt her. In her mind, she rehearsed over and over all of the offenses and wrongs that had been committed against her. She wanted so badly to get even.

One night while praying, she realized that all those negative feelings were blocking her from moving forward. She knew she had to let go of the past offenses. She wasn't sure how to do it, but she began imagining a large assortment of helium–filled balloons in her hand. Each balloon represented an offense, a concern, or a hurt in her life. She then pictured herself releasing those balloons one at a time and watching them float away. As she did this, she could almost feel each of those offenses, cares, and concerns that had been consuming her thoughts begin to lift off of her. Each time she practiced this exercise, she released her cares and concerns to God and received a fresh portion of His strength to face each day. Eventually, she found her place of peace as she released those balloons and learned to forgive.

Why don't you release your balloons today? Let go of all offenses and give them to God. You can accomplish so much more when you allow forgiveness to fill your heart.

And whenever you stand praying, if you have anything against anyone, forgive him and let it drop (leave it, let it go), in order that your Father Who is in heaven may also forgive you…(Mark 11:25, AMP).
